ATTENTION WWA
MEMBERS: The Young Professionals Committee of the WWA is proud
to announce that educational scholarships are again available for
the 2005-2006 school year. Three categories of scholarships are
available:
-
Category 1:
Full time university student pursuing an education in the water
supply field. Applicant must be of junior status or higher, a
U.S. citizen and resident of the State of Wisconsin enrolled in
a university within the state of Wisconsin. Minimum cumulative
grade point average is 3.0. The applicant must not have received
the WWA scholarship in this field previously. (1 scholarship is
available at $750)
-
Category 2:
Full time technical student pursuing an education or
training in the water supply field. Applicant must be a U.S.
citizens and resident of the State of Wisconsin enrolled in a
Wisconsin technical school and have completed at least one
semester. Minimum cumulative grade point average is 3.0. The
applicant must not have received the WWA scholarship in this
field previously. (1 scholarship is available at $500)
-
Category 3:
High school senior whom is a son/daughter of a WWA member and
who is enrolled full time in a university for the fall semester
of the upcoming 2005 – 2006 school year. Minimum cumulative
grade point average is 3.0. The applicant must not have received
the WWA scholarship in this field previously. (1 scholarship is
available at $500)
Applications are available below and submissions must be
postmarked by April 1, 2005 to be eligible. For more information
